
Ghanaian footballers across the globe delivered standout performances over the weekend of October 9, 2023, making significant impacts in top-tier European leagues and emerging divisions alike. From the high-stakes English Premier League to the competitive fields of La Liga and beyond, the "Black Stars" representatives showcased their quality, reinforcing Ghana's reputation as a powerhouse of footballing talent. The weekend was marked by crucial goals and influential substitutions that proved decisive for their respective clubs. In the English Premier League, Antoine Semenyo was featured prominently after finding the net for Manchester City, demonstrating his rising profile in one of the world's most demanding leagues. Meanwhile, in Spain, Inaki Williams continued his impressive form for Athletic Club. The striker, who has become a focal point for the Bilbao-based side, found the back of the net in La Liga, further solidifying his status as a key asset for both club and country. These performances in the "Big Five" leagues underscore the high level at which Ghanaian professionals are currently competing. Beyond the major spotlights of England and Spain, Ghanaian talent shone in several other European territories. In Albania, Bismark Charles was on target for Vllaznia, contributing a vital goal to their campaign. In Cyprus, David Abagna made an immediate impact for APOEL Nicosia; appearing as a substitute, his energy and tactical awareness provided a necessary boost for his side.
